R560 TYD is a 1998 General Motors Cadillac in Blue with a 4,565c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 4 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 50%.
Across all 1998 General Motors Cadillac models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.0% with a typical mileage of 67,485 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a General Motors Cadillac f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 279 recorded failures. If you're considering buying R560 TYD,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The General Motors Cadillac typ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 28 years old, this General Motors Cadillac is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
